One of the New York Yankees' prospects earned a well-deserved promotion. Catcher/first baseman Ben Rice, who ranks as the Yankees' 12th best prospect, was promoted from the Double-A Somerset Patriots to the Triple-A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Riders on Wednesday.

Carlos Rodon retired the first 16 hitters he faced and pitched six solid innings as the New York Yankees recorded a 9-5 victory over the visiting Minnesota Twins on Wednesday night.
The Yanks won their seventh game in a row with one of the more complete team victories of the season. Each day brings a new marvel from Aaron Judge. Today, it was a bases-clearing triple in the fifth — his first in five years — as the captain finished the day with five RBIs.
